Cellular acidosis triggers human MondoA transcriptional activity by driving mitochondrial ATP production

Human MondoA requires glucose as well as other modulatory signals to function in transcription. One such signal is acidosis, which increases MondoA activity and also drives a protective gene signature in breast cancer. How low pH controls MondoA transcriptional activity is unknown.
